Abstract
Objective To compare clinical success rates of Er∶YAG laser combined with different capping agents for direct pulp capping in primary teeth and evaluate the pain during treatment.Methods A total of 60 teeth of 60 children between the age of 3 and 5 years were selected for this study.All the samples were randomly assigned to the following 4groups (n=1 5):Er∶YAG laser+ MTA,the exposed area was sealed with MTA after Er∶YAG laser for caries removal and cavity preparation;Er∶YAG laser+calcium hydroxide (CH),the treated area was sealed with CH paste after Er∶YAG laser for caries removal;dental handpiece+MTA,the exposed pulp was sealed with MTA after dental handpiece for caries removal;dental handpiece+CH,CH was applied after dental handpiece for caries removal.The depth of cavity preparation was recorded while the child felt painful.At the 3-,6-,12-and 24-month recall examiations,the effect was observed by X-ray.Results The proportion of the depth of cavity preparation (superficial dentin,middle dentin,deep dentin)by handpiece and Er∶YAG laser was 50%,40%,10% and 0.67%,20%,79.33%,respectively.The two patterns of cavity preparation revealed significant difference (P < 0.05),At the 3-,6-,12-month recall examiations,the success rates of the laser groups were higher than the handpiece groups,while they had no significant difference (P > 0.05).At the 24 months,the success rates of the laser groups were 93.3%.They showed significantly higher success rates than the handpiece groups (P < 0.05).The success rates of handpiece+MTA and handpiece+CH were 80% (12/15)and 73% (11/15),which did not reveal any significant difference.Conclusion Er∶YAG laser combined with pulp capping agents can be recommended for direct pulp therapy in primary teeth,and Er∶YAG laser will result in a slight pain,thus the children will be inclined to accept and complete the treatment.The clinical effect of MTA shows no statistical difference compared with CH.关键词
